Walkway Resurfacing in Des Moines, IA
Walkway resurfacing services involve restoring and improving existing walkways, paths, or sidewalks to enhance safety, appearance, and durability. This service covers a variety of projects, including repairing cracked or uneven surfaces, applying new coatings or overlays, and refreshing worn-out concrete or paving materials. Property owners typically seek walkway resurfacing to improve curb appeal, prevent trip hazards, and extend the lifespan of their outdoor pathways, especially in areas with high foot traffic or exposure to the elements.
Before requesting walkway resurfacing, property owners should consider the current condition of their walkways, including any structural damage, surface deterioration, or drainage issues. It’s important to understand the types of materials and finishes available, as well as any preparation work needed to ensure a long-lasting result. Clarifying project scope, budget, and desired aesthetic outcomes can help ensure the resurfacing process meets expectations and maintains the safety and functionality of outdoor walkways.

Walkway Resurfacing Questions
What surfaces can be resurfaced? Walkway resurfacing can be applied to concrete, asphalt, and other paving materials to improve appearance and durability.
What are common projects for walkway resurfacing? Typical projects include repairing cracks, restoring worn surfaces, and updating the look of residential or commercial walkways.
Is walkway resurfacing suitable for damaged surfaces? Yes, resurfacing can address issues like cracks, uneven areas, and surface deterioration to extend the life of the walkway.
What should property owners consider before resurfacing? It's important to assess the current condition of the walkway and choose a resurfacing method that matches the existing surface and usage needs.
